We are seeking an organised and proactive individual to support the effective management of our CAFM system and facilities operations. This role requires excellent time management and the ability to balance a varied workload in a fast-paced environment. You will be responsible for maintaining accurate CAFM records, including asset data, PPM schedules and reactive maintenance logs, and supporting reporting for compliance, performance and audit purposes. Working closely with internal teams and external contractors, you will help ensure PPM tasks are completed on time, data is validated and system accuracy is maintained. The role also involves monitoring and escalating overdue tasks, onboarding new assets and services, providing first-line system support, and contributing to service improvements and system upgrades. In addition, you will assist with ordering and managing stock, tools and equipment, raising orders in line with Trust SFIs, and maintaining records for the centrally held tool bank. A strong attention to detail, good communication skills and a commitment to compliance with Health & Safety, Information Governance and Infection Prevention policies are essential. About us
